Holi, the festival of colours, will be celebrated on 25 March. On this day people play and enjoy with different colours. However, the biggest challenge of playing Holi is removing the colours afterwards. Although it is always advisable to play Holi with natural colours and take precautions regarding skin and hair care, sometimes guests bring colours that are difficult to remove.

People often do many things to remove the colour from their faces. They scrub their skin vigorously with water and soap, which can potentially damage the skin and cause dryness and rashes. Therefore, after playing Holi, you can also use these home remedies to remove stubborn colours.

Coconut Oil:

Coconut oil can help in removing stubborn colours from the face. Massage the areas from which you want to remove colour with coconut oil. Let it soak into the skin and the discoloration will gradually fade away. Just remember not to rub the face too hard. Leave it on for at least 30 minutes before washing it off with a mild cleanser.

Cucumber:

You can also use cucumber to remove the colours of Holi. Grate the cucumber to extract its juice. Then add a little rose water and vinegar to it. Apply this mixture to your face with the help of cotton. Wash your face with water after 10-15 minutes. This can help in lightening the colour spots.

Aloe Vera Gel:

Aloe Vera Gel helps in hydrating the skin. Apply fresh aloe vera gel directly to your skin and hair and massage gently. After 20-30 minutes, wash it off with lukewarm water. This can also help in removing the colours of Holi.

Curd and turmeric:

Add a pinch of turmeric powder to plain curd. Apply this mixture to your skin. Especially where colour is applied, leave it on for 20-30 minutes before washing it off with lukewarm water. This can help in lightening the colour spots.
